@Entity public class JPANotificationTask extends AbstractTask implements NotificationTask
TABLE
LOG
EMAIL_PATTERN, ID_PATTERN, ID_REGEX
Constructor and Description |
---|
JPANotificationTask() |
Modifier and Type | Method and Description |
---|---|
AnyTypeKind |
getAnyTypeKind() |
String |
getEntityKey() |
String |
getHtmlBody() |
Notification |
getNotification() |
Set<String> |
getRecipients() |
String |
getSender() |
String |
getSubject() |
String |
getTextBody() |
TraceLevel |
getTraceLevel() |
boolean |
isExecuted() |
void |
setAnyTypeKind(AnyTypeKind anyTypeKind) |
void |
setEntityKey(String entityKey) |
void |
setExecuted(boolean executed) |
void |
setHtmlBody(String htmlBody) |
void |
setNotification(Notification notification) |
void |
setSender(String sender) |
void |
setSubject(String subject) |
void |
setTextBody(String textBody) |
void |
setTraceLevel(TraceLevel traceLevel) |
add, getExecs
getKey, setKey
checkImplementationType, checkType, equals, hashCode, toString
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
public Notification getNotification()
getNotification
in interface NotificationTask
public void setNotification(Notification notification)
setNotification
in interface NotificationTask
public AnyTypeKind getAnyTypeKind()
getAnyTypeKind
in interface NotificationTask
public void setAnyTypeKind(AnyTypeKind anyTypeKind)
setAnyTypeKind
in interface NotificationTask
public String getEntityKey()
getEntityKey
in interface NotificationTask
public void setEntityKey(String entityKey)
setEntityKey
in interface NotificationTask
public Set<String> getRecipients()
getRecipients
in interface NotificationTask
public String getSender()
getSender
in interface NotificationTask
public void setSender(String sender)
setSender
in interface NotificationTask
public String getSubject()
getSubject
in interface NotificationTask
public void setSubject(String subject)
setSubject
in interface NotificationTask
public String getTextBody()
getTextBody
in interface NotificationTask
public void setTextBody(String textBody)
setTextBody
in interface NotificationTask
public String getHtmlBody()
getHtmlBody
in interface NotificationTask
public void setHtmlBody(String htmlBody)
setHtmlBody
in interface NotificationTask
public boolean isExecuted()
isExecuted
in interface NotificationTask
public void setExecuted(boolean executed)
setExecuted
in interface NotificationTask
public TraceLevel getTraceLevel()
getTraceLevel
in interface NotificationTask
public void setTraceLevel(TraceLevel traceLevel)
setTraceLevel
in interface NotificationTask
Copyright © 2010–2023 The Apache Software Foundation. All rights reserved.